码迷,mamicode.com
首页 > Web开发 > 详细

jquery 添加可操作,编辑不可操作

时间:2017-02-22 19:20:23      阅读:257      评论:0      收藏:0      [点我收藏+]

标签:jquer   enable   checked   --   val   name   jquery   ndt   ttext   

--jsp

 <td class="queryTitle" width="100">优惠券批次号</td>
                        <td class="queryContent" width="100">

                            <input class="inputText easyui-validatebox" type="text" id="EditPubliId" />
                        </td>

--js

//添加优惠券促销窗口
function addCouExDlg(){
    //添加时去掉不可编辑
    $("#EditPubliId").removeAttr("readonly");
    $("#hideActivityId").val(‘‘);
    $(‘#EditActName‘).val(‘‘);
    $(‘#EditActNo‘).val(‘‘);
    $(‘#EditActBeginDate‘).combo(‘setText‘,‘‘);
    $(‘#EditActEndDate‘).combo(‘setText‘,‘‘);
    $("#EditConditionType").combobox(‘setValue‘,"0");
    $("#EditCjType").combobox(‘setValue‘,"1");
    $(‘#EditCjCount‘).val(‘‘);
    $(‘#EditPubliId‘).val(‘‘);

    $(‘#EidtActivityDesc‘).val(‘‘);
    $("input[name=‘publishRangeC‘]").attr("checked",false); 

    $(‘#addCouponPromoteDlg‘).window({
        title:‘优惠券促销添加‘,
        iconCls:‘icon-add‘,
        width:693,
        height:300,
        left:100,
        modal: true,
        shadow: true,
        collapsible:false,
        minimizable:false,
        maximizable:false
    });
    $(‘#addCouponPromoteDlg‘).window(‘move‘,{top:100});
    $(‘#addCouponPromoteDlg‘).window(‘open‘);
}

--修改

//优惠券活动修改框
function showEdit(rowData){//dataStr
    // $("#EditPubliId").removeAttr("readonly");
    $("#hideActivityId").val(rowData.cjActivityId);
    $(‘#EditActName‘).val(rowData.activityName);
    $(‘#EditActNo‘).val(rowData.activityNo);
    $(‘#EditActBeginDate‘).datebox("setValue",rowData.beginTime);
    $(‘#EditActEndDate‘).datebox("setValue",rowData.endTime);
    $("#EditConditionType").combobox(‘setValue‘,rowData.conditionType);
    if(rowData.isEnable==‘Y‘){
        $(‘input[name="isUseR"][value="Y"]‘).attr(‘checked‘, true);
    }else if(rowData.isEnable==‘N‘){
        $(‘input[name="isUseR"][value="N"]‘).attr(‘checked‘, true);
    }
    $("#EditCjType").combobox(‘setValue‘,rowData.cjType);

    if(rowData.publishRange==null ||rowData.publishRange==‘‘){
        $("input[name=‘publishRangeC‘]").attr("checked",false);
    }
    //checkbox 数据回显
    var publishRange=rowData.publishRange.split(",");
    for(var i = 0;i < publishRange.length; i++) {
        $("input[name=‘publishRangeC‘][value="+publishRange[i]+"]").attr(‘checked‘, true);
    }
    //定义隐藏域
    $("#hiddendActivityNo").val(rowData.activityNo);
    $("#hiddendPublishId").val(rowData.publishId);
    $(‘#EditCjCount‘).val(rowData.cjCount);
    $(‘#EditPubliId‘).val(rowData.publishId);
    if(rowData.publishId!=null){
        $("#EditPubliId").attr("readonly","readonly");
    }
    $(‘#EidtActivityDesc‘).val(rowData.activityDesc);
    $(‘#addCouponPromoteDlg‘).window({
        title:‘优惠券活动编辑‘,
        iconCls:‘icon-add‘,
        width:693,
        height:300,
        left:100,
        modal: true,
        shadow: true,
        collapsible:false,
        minimizable:false,
        maximizable:false
    });
    $(‘#addCouponPromoteDlg‘).window(‘move‘,{top:100});
    $(‘#addCouponPromoteDlg‘).window(‘open‘);
}

--添加

//保存优惠券促销活动
function saveCouponPromote(){
    var cjActivityId = $("#hideActivityId").val();
    var activityName = $(‘#EditActName‘).val();
    var activityNo = $(‘#EditActNo‘).val();
    var beginTime = $(‘#EditActBeginDate‘).datebox("getValue");
    var endTime = $(‘#EditActEndDate‘).datebox("getValue");
    var conditionType = $("#EditConditionType").combobox(‘getValue‘);
    var isEnable = $("input[name=‘isUseR‘]:checked").val();

    var cjType = $("#EditCjType").combobox(‘getValue‘);
    
    var cjCount = $(‘#EditCjCount‘).val();
    var publishId = $(‘#EditPubliId‘).val();
    var cjValue = $(‘#EditPubliId‘).val();
    var activityDesc = $(‘#EidtActivityDesc‘).val();
    if(checkCouponDate(publishId) == "expire"){
        $.messager.alert(‘提示‘,‘优惠券有效期已过!‘);
        return;
    }

//        if(cjActivityId==null||cjActivityId==‘‘){
        if($(‘#hiddendActivityNo‘).val()!=activityNo){
            if(!checkActivityNo(activityNo)){
              $.messager.alert(‘提示‘,‘活动编码已存在!‘);
              return;
        }
          
//        }
    }
//   if(!checkPublishId(publishId)){
//        $.messager.alert(‘提示‘,‘优惠券批次号已存在!‘);
//        return;
//    }
  
       if($(‘#hiddendPublishId‘).val()!=publishId){
           if(!checkPromotePublishId(cjValue)){
           $.messager.alert(‘提示‘,‘优惠券批次号已存在!‘);
           return;
       }
      
   }

 

jquery 添加可操作,编辑不可操作

标签:jquer   enable   checked   --   val   name   jquery   ndt   ttext   

原文地址:http://www.cnblogs.com/wangchuanfu/p/6430105.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!